Description
each featuring a serene English countryside scene depicting figures in boats, an arched bridge and cottage, and a church-like structure and sheep on hill in background, with a rose floral border, comprising nine with blue transfer including six plates, two soup plates, and a saucer, and two with brown/sepia transfer including a small dish and an 8 3/4" D plate. Marks to underside include printed ribbon with "WILD ROSE / S M & Co", a royal coat of arms with "WILD ROSE" above and "MANN & CO / HANLEY" below, a crown with flowers having "STONE / WARE" to interior and "WILD ROSE" inscribed to ribbon, a garter with "WILD ROSE" to interior and "S & Co" below, and impressed "SEWELL", "MOORE & Co", and "6". Samuel Moore & Co., Sunderland; Mann & Co., Hanley; Sewell & Co., Newcastle-upon-Tyne, Northumberland, England; Staffordshire and other areas. 19th century. 1" HOA; plates 5 3/4" to 10 1/8" D.
Provenance: From the Charles Pearson collection, Appomattox, VA.

Condition
Six undamaged, except some having minor wear and/or crazing; saucer having minor rim flake, possibly as made; four plates having faint rim hairline primarily visible to underside due decoration.
